Board accepts McGrath bid for facade painting; $50,000 TIF plus district funds to cover balance

Whitehall School District Board of Trustees · April 8, 2026

Summary

The Whitehall board approved McGrath Painting and Construction's $174,255 bid for a façade painting and repair project; staff said $50,000 will come from TIF and the approximate $125,000 remainder from the district multi-district account.

The board voted to accept McGrath Painting and Construction's bid of $174,255 for the district's façade painting and repair project after staff said two other bidders submitted incomplete proposals. The superintendent summarized bids and funding, noting McGrath's bid was about $65,000 below the other completed proposal from A and R Construction ($246,083).

"So our recommendation is to accept the bid of McGrath Painting and Construction," the superintendent said. Staff told trustees the district received $50,000 from TIF and plans to use the multi-district account to cover the remaining cost (approximately $125,000). The motion to accept the McGrath bid passed by voice vote.
